Le Retatrutide (LY3437943) is a triple-agonist research peptide developed for the simultaneous study of the GLP-1R, GIPR, and glucagon receptor (GCGR) signaling pathways. This triagonist offers researchers a unique tool for the comparative analysis of metabolic cascades involving all three incretin receptors within a unified in vitro model.
Structurally, retatrutide features a peptide backbone with simulated post-translational modifications — notably side-chain acylation — enabling controlled differential affinity toward the three receptor targets. Its binding profile presents analytical value in ligand-receptor competition and allosteric regulation studies.
